Iapygia, also known as Apulia, was a historical region in the southeastern extremity of Italy, located between the Apennine Mountains and the Adriatic Sea, and bordered by the Lucania and Samnium regions.

Historically, Iapygia was inhabited by a group of peoples together known as the Iapyges, comprising the Dauni, Peuceti and Messapii. Though the exact origin of the Iapyges isn't known for sure, they are often believed to have been closely related to the Illyrians (and are represented as such in-game). Iapygia received a few Greek colonies starting in the 8th Century BC, making it part of Magna Graecia. The Romans started their conquest of the region in the 4th Century BC during the Samnite Wars, reaching its conclusion in the 3rd Century BC after the Pyrrhic War.
